instructions do not make any sence. no matter what i input it says colors is not defined or red is not defined. colors = [red, blue, green, yellow, white] what is wrong???

You're pretty much there, except the colors need to be in quotation marks as they would be considered strings. Right now, without quotation marks around each one, Python thinks they are variables, which is why you are getting the 'undefined' error.

colors = ["red", "blue", "green", "yellow", "black"]
